diff options
Diffstat (limited to '.travis.yml')
-rw-r--r-- | .travis.yml | 24 |
1 files changed, 14 insertions, 10 deletions
diff --git a/.travis.yml b/.travis.yml index a01bf055..29d0897c 100644 --- a/.travis.yml +++ b/.travis.yml @@ -10,24 +10,31 @@ addons: packages: - libssl-dev +env: + global: + - CI_DEPS=codecov>=2.0.5 + - CI_COMMANDS=codecov + matrix: fast_finish: true include: - python: 2.7 - env: TOXENV=py27-ci + env: TOXENV=py27 - python: 2.7 - env: TOXENV=py27-ci NO_ALPN=1 + env: TOXENV=py27 NO_ALPN=1 - python: 3.5 - env: TOXENV=py35-ci + env: TOXENV=py35 - python: 3.5 - env: TOXENV=py35-ci NO_ALPN=1 + env: TOXENV=py35 NO_ALPN=1 - language: generic - env: TOXENV=py27-ci os: osx osx_image: xcode7.1 git: depth: 9999999 - - python: 2.7 + env: TOXENV=py27 + - python: 3.5 + env: TOXENV=lint + - python: 3.5 env: TOXENV=docs allow_failures: - python: pypy @@ -42,10 +49,7 @@ install: fi - pip install tox -before_script: - - "tox -e lint" - -script: tox +script: set -o pipefail; tox -- --cov netlib --cov mitmproxy --cov pathod 2>&1 | grep -v Cryptography_locking_cb after_success: - | |